YouTube has become a content miracle. Dorsum in 2005 when the first YouTube video Me At The Zoo was uploaded, nobody would have imagined simply how important this video sharing medium was going to be. Google conspicuously saw the potential of YouTube, all the same, and only 18 months after YouTube'south co-founder shared his zoo visit with the globe, Google appear it was paying $i.65 billion for the service.
Since so the ability and influence of YouTube have grown at breath-taking speed. Information technology can even claim to be the earth'southward second largest search engine - afterward Google itself. Some of its statistics are quite staggering:
- Total number of people who use YouTube - two,600,000,000
- Hours of video uploaded to YouTube every minute - 500 hours
- Number of videos viewed on YouTube every day - 4,950,000,000
- Average number of mobile YouTube videos per day - 1,000,000,000
Google deputed a survey in 2016 to empathize what the latest viewing trends on YouTube were. Some highlights of the survey were:
- 6 out of x people prefer online video platforms to live TV
- In an average month, 8 out of 10 18-49-yer-olds watch YouTube
- On mobile alone, YouTube reaches more 18-49-twelvemonth-olds than any broadcast or cablevision tv network
In 2017 Google turned their attention to people watching YouTube on their televisions sets. Highlights from this study include:
- The fourth dimension people spend watching YouTube on a tv set has doubled in a twelvemonth
- 2 out of three YouTube viewers say they watch YouTube on a tv screen
- Just similar tv content, watching YouTube on tv screens peaks around prime fourth dimension
- Picket time of YouTube on TVs peaks at the weekend
Then, with so much fourth dimension spent watching YouTube, on a wide variety of devices, what types of content are people watching? It turns out that people watch a wide diversity of things actually, which is probably reflective of the fact that YouTube viewers now span the whole spectrum of ages and types of people.
Of course, to many people, YouTube has one purpose only – it's an piece of cake way to watch music videos. And music videos can't exist ignored - there are and then many of them! According to the Wikipedia Listing of Almost Viewed YouTube Videos, "See You Again" past Wiz Khalifa featuring Charlie Puth has had an incredible 2.916 billion views, and has recently overtaken the long-time King of YouTube, "Gangnam Style" to be the leader. In fact, music videos accept up 77 out of the fourscore videos in this top list.

ane. Funny Animals
It is impossible to avoid seeing funny animals on the internet - Facebook feeds, in detail, seem at times to be full of the critters. People just dearest seeing cute animals, particularly when they are doing something out of the ordinary - videos of cats sleeping aren't the rage this year!
YouTube also has its fair share of funny animal channels, some depicting videos of existent animals pigging the limelight, others - like Simons True cat - existence animated.
There are as well, of course, numerous serious animate being channels, including National Geographic videos featuring the renowned David Attenborough.
2. Video Game Walkthroughs
We may have deliberately excluded the ubiquitous music video from this roundup, but we couldn't exclude this category of video, despite it being where number one influencer, PewDiePie rules the roost.
Immature males (the most mutual type of gamer) were the first blazon of people to embrace YouTube, and so it should be no surprise that there are thousands of channels related to video gaming. Minecraft lone is popular enough to have a website devoted to list over i,000 top Minecraft YouTube channels.
A common type of gaming video is a walkthrough, where somebody plays a game, commentating as they progress through the game. 1 of the reasons for Minecraft's popularity (despite its old-time graphics) is that the game is easily moddable, and the filmmakers brand use of this feature in their videos, where they oftentimes play as modded characters.
There can exist huge date betwixt gaming video makers and their supporters and there tin can even exist live play sessions.
3. How To Guides and Tutorials
There are three types of learning style: visual (by seeing), auditory (by hearing) and kinesthetic (by doing). Everybody learns using a combination of these styles, but almost people find one of the methods easier than the others. Adept teachers attempt to use a mixture of all iii methods in their classrooms.
While it will always exist difficult to teach kinesthetically in a video, information technology is the perfect medium for those who love both visual and auditory learning experiences. A well-structured video, that encourages yous to piece of work alongside the presentation, can even be useful to the more kinesthetically-inclined.
There are so many How To videos on YouTube, that you are likely to find something to help you practise about annihilation you lot can think of.
These videos have an reward in that they are nigh timeless - the only reason that a video would appointment is that the activity itself changes or goes out of date.
4. Product Reviews
There is a articulate trend, nowadays, for people to plough to the internet when they are considering making a purchase. They desire to discover what other people recall about products that involvement them.
YouTube is no different from other social media aqueduct in this sense. People flock to the channels of those they trust to see what they think most various products they have reviewed.
Polls accept regularly shown that consumers are more likely to make a purchase if they come across a positive review online.
It apparently depends on the product, but YouTube is the perfect medium for many products. People find it and then much easier to relate to a review if they can physically run into the production being used, whether it is makeup existence applied, a car being test driven, or the latest kitchen gadget existence put to utilize.

half dozen. Vlogs
A blog, actually short for weblog but nearly people accept forgotten that present, started off as a spider web-based log of what a person did each day - a grade of Internet-based diary. Of course, blogs have diversified since then, but you will still find brilliant and breezy people happily writing about their daily breakfast and what they managed to reach the day before.
Vlogs are video blogs, and the idea is, to some extent, the same as what the original blog was. They are effectively a video equivalent of your one-time diary.
Of course, being on YouTube they are somewhat more public than a diary hidden under the bed, so the content is unremarkably more engaging.
Like a diary, vlogs use unscripted dialog and generally come across as an authentic wait into the video maker'south heed. They often focus on a specific topic.
Vlogs are oft the YouTube equivalent of reality television. Yous get a take chances to encounter into the life (or at least as much as they are prepared to share) of the vlogger. Simply as reality idiot box can generate some scarily loftier viewing numbers, quite a few vlogs channels accept a considerable number of followers.

9. Unboxing Videos
Unboxing videos are very much a 21st Century phenomenon. A surprisingly large number of people like to watch somebody else take a new production out of a box!
These are extensions of both shopping spree/haul videos and production review videos - in reality, they fit somewhere in between the procedure of purchasing a product and the act of using and reviewing the product.
In some ways the honey for these videos tin can exist paralleled past a child's love of Christmas morning - half the fun is unwrapping the presents and seeing what is within. Information technology is the aforementioned for unboxing videos, equally the viewer is given the opportunity to join in with the anticipation of seeing for the first fourth dimension the contents of the packet.
As with both haul videos and reviews, unboxing videos tin can have a huge impact on consumer buying decisions and can be very lucrative for brands. This is another area with huge potential for influencer marketing.
